IB/mthca: Fix max_srq_sge returned by ib_query_device for Tavor devices
The driver allocates SRQ WQEs size with a power of 2 size both for Tavor and for memfree. For Tavor, however, the hardware only requires the WQE size to be a multiple of 16, not a power of 2, and the max number of scatter-gather allowed is reported accordingly by the firmware (and this is the value currently returned by ib_query_device() and ibv_query_device()). If the max number of scatter/gather entries reported by the FW is used when creating an SRQ, the creation will fail for Tavor, since the required WQE size will be increased to the next power of 2, which turns out to be larger than the device permitted max WQE size (which is not a power of 2). This patch reduces the reported SRQ max wqe size so that it can be used successfully in creating an SRQ on Tavor HCAs.
